Three more fires were lit in Greenwood overnight, bringing the arson tally to ten. Firefighters rushed to the first fire at Moonphoto on 77th and Greenwood around 11 p.m. but quickly extinguished it. A few hours later at 4 a.m. a second fire was called in at “Olive You” restaurant on Greenwood Ave.

A third fire was discovered at 8 a.m. this morning at the Greenwood Quickstop, and was also quickly put out. In response to all the recent arson attacks, the Seattle Fire Department is conducting arson patrols throughout the neighborhood.
